Debunking the Myths

Some people argue that cats are easier to care for because they require less attention. However, the independence that cats are known for can sometimes feel like emotional distance. While cats might be content on their own, dogs actively seek out connection, making them more integrated into the daily lives of their owners. In terms of care, while cats may groom themselves, the maintenance of a cat can involve tasks that aren’t necessarily easier than caring for a dog. Litter boxes require frequent cleaning, and cats can be particular about their space. Dogs, with proper training, are generally easier to manage in terms of hygiene and living space.

Science Supports the Dog-Human Connection

Research consistently shows that living with dogs can improve human health and happiness. From lowering stress levels to encouraging more physical activity, the benefits of having a dog go far beyond companionship. Scientific studies have highlighted how interacting with dogs can trigger positive emotions, reduce anxiety, and even improve cardiovascular health. Dogs have an intuitive way of connecting with people, making them excellent therapy animals and companions for those needing emotional support. Their ability to sense human emotions and respond in kind is something truly special.
